Finance is a broad discipline, covering topics that affect individuals, organizations and society. Careers in the financial realm require strong mathematical, computer and communication skills. At Haub, finance majors learn how individuals, businesses and governments raise money, select investments and manage resources, while gaining an innovative understanding of global financial markets.

Eligibility & Entry Requirement
- Submit official high school transcripts or copies certified by high school or EducationUSA Center.
- One letter from either a teacher or a counselor.
- Resume uploaded to your SJU Admission Account.
- ACT or SAT Scores may be sent directly from the testing agenct.
